BladeForums and other similar sales sites have been plagued by scammers who post or send emails pretending to be a seller.

Do not respond to emails. BF treats email addresses as confidential. We do not disclose email addresses to members. Wait until the seller responds in the thread.

A favorite trick of scammers is to create an account with a name that resembles the seller's member name. Then they post in the thread and pose as the seller. So if someone posts in the thread, check their post count and membership level before believing they are who they purport to be.
